Voltage Reference Analog Devices, Inc. MAX875AESA+ Overview

The Voltage Reference Analog Devices, Inc. MAX875AESA+ is a highly precise and reliable series voltage reference IC designed for a wide array of applications requiring stable and accurate voltage references. Manufactured by Analog Devices, a leader in precision circuit components, the MAX875AESA+ stands out with its excellent stability and low temperature coefficient, making it ideal for critical and demanding applications. This component guarantees a low output noise along with a remarkable 0.04% initial accuracy, making it a top choice for engineers focusing on high-performance designs.

MAX875AESA+ Features

The MAX875AESA+ features include a tight initial accuracy of 0.04%, low operating current, and a wide operating temperature range. Its SOIC-8 package ensures compatibility with standard surface-mount processes, making it easy to integrate into various circuit designs. This IC also provides low dropout characteristics, which is beneficial for applications with limited power supply options.
